What skills and experience we're looking for

We are seeking an experienced SENCo to join our dedicated team at Kenmore Park Junior School. The ideal candidate will possess:

  • Qualified Teacher Status (QTS)

  • National Award for SEN Coordination or NPQ in Special Educational Needs or working towards this qualification

  • A proven track record as an excellent classroom teacher

  • Ability to form strong relationships with a range of stakeholders

  • The ability to lead a team of Teaching Assistants (TAs)

  • Strong communication and organisational skills

  • The capability to offer expert advice and support to teaching staff

  • Experience on an SLT

  • Safeguarding Experience

As a member of our Senior Management Team you will have a direct impact on the strategic direction of the school.

Commitment to safeguarding

Our organisation is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children, young people and vulnerable adults. We expect all staff, volunteers and trustees to share this commitment.

Our recruitment process follows the keeping children safe in education guidance.

Offers of employment may be subject to the following checks (where relevant):
childcare disqualification
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S)
medical
online and social media
prohibition from teaching
right to work
satisfactory references
suitability to work with children

You must tell us about any unspent conviction, cautions, reprimands or warnings under the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act 1974 (Exceptions) Order 1975.
